Transaction e5894143c394f2f45a397dbd933fd0581500195f6d49efda909e9913cf35181c
1 Input
1 Output
-
e5894143c394f2f45a397dbd933fd0581500195f6d49efda909e9913cf35181c:0
- value
- 590409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 465d9123e500a0ed1a7712bff893c478333d2d4d OP_EQUAL
- address
- 3875K7nb9JWDmrHzPdDKc9x9G4p3YT5sZx